Porcelain tile
Dense, low-absorption ceramic tile suitable for floors. Available in stone-look, wood-look, concrete-look, or solid-color formats.

Cost notes
Through-body porcelain hides chips. Large-format tiles (24"×48"+) require flatter substrates.

Code notes
Specify DCOF ≥ 0.42 for wet residential per ANSI A137.1.
